Getting tier 1 pvp lost ark

While there are a number of strategies that can help you get the best performance in PvP in Lost Ark, there are some classes that are a better option than others. There are five general classes and 15 unique classes. Each class has its own playstyle and skills. You can choose a class based on your playstyle, class skill level, and the balance of the classes in the game.

In order to enter competitive PVP in Lost Ark, you must reach Level 20 and unlock the Proving Grounds. Once you’ve achieved this, you can take part in the Lost Ark season, which starts at a certain point and lasts for six months or longer, depending on the announcement from the server. You’ll need to win a lot of matches to earn Tier 1 rankings, so it’s important to get a high Competitive Match Average Score. Fortunately, there are several ways to earn these points.

The easiest way to get tier one in PVP in Lost Ark is to participate in as many ranked matches as you can. Getting to Tier 1 in PvP is quite easy once you reach Level 20 and have gained access to the Luterra Castle. You must have your own champion, so be sure not to switch champions after losing. Choosing a class for pvp lost ark

When selecting a class for Lost Ark, consider how you will use it, particularly when you’ll be playing in teams. Choosing a class that synergizes well with other classes will be more effective than one that relies on its own abilities. You can also consider a hybrid class to add more damage-dealing power to your team and improve your survivability. Some hybrid classes include Gunlancer, Paladin, and Bard. You can also choose a class like Gunslinger, which is a technical class that rewards risky play.

There are many classes to choose from in Lost Ark, so take time to pick the best one for your play style. If you plan to use the character for PVE, you’ll probably want to choose a PVE-focused class. Some of the most popular classes are the Gunlancer, Paladin, and Bard. All of these have excellent buffs. There are many other PVE-focused classes you can try, including Mage, Shaman, and Ranger.

The power of each class is based on a number of factors, including survivability, damage, stagger checks, and destruction checks. While every class has strengths and weaknesses, classes that synergize are best. However, any class in Lost Ark is a viable choice if you have a strong team.
